164K Rideshare vehicle licence—decision on application for
renewal
application for renewal of a rideshare vehicle licence under
section 164J.
(2) The authority may renew the licence only if satisfied that—
(a) the vehicle continues to—
(i) be a registered vehicle; and
(ii) be a suitable vehicle; and
(iii) comply with the applicable vehicle standards for the
(b) the licensee is not disqualified from applying for a rideshare
vehicle licence.
Note A person may be disqualified from applying for a licence for a
period of time if another licence has been suspended or cancelled
(see s 322).
(3) The road transport authority may refuse to renew the licence if—
(a) the authority believes on reasonable grounds that the licensee
has contravened a condition of the licence or another rideshare
vehicle licence; or
(b) another rideshare vehicle licence, or an accreditation to operate
any kind of public passenger service, held by the licensee is
suspended under chapter 8 (Disciplinary action).
(4) If the authority decides to renew the licence, the authority may impose
or amend a condition on the licence.
